The company presents a Piotroski F-Score of 5/9, indicating stable financial health, but this is heavily overshadowed by a catastrophic price collapse of -91.1% over the last year. While valuation metrics like Price/Book (0.11) and Price/Sales (0.11) suggest extreme undervaluation, the lack of an Altman Z-Score and Graham Number indicates insufficient or unreliable data for traditional defensive valuation. The combination of negative profit margins and a 0/100 technical trend suggests a classic value trap scenario.
NTWK presents a contradictory profile characterized by a weak Piotroski F-Score of 3/9, indicating deteriorating fundamental health, despite strong liquidity ratios. While the stock trades near its Graham Number ($3.31) and shows impressive revenue growth of 21.10%, the bearish technical trend and low intrinsic value ($1.12) suggest significant headwinds. The valuation is supported by a low Price/Sales ratio (0.60) and a promising forward P/E of 9.32, but operational instability remains a primary concern.
